The Indigenous Youth Programmer supports the IYEP Coordinator to plan, implement, and evaluate the Indigenous Youth Employment Program. The Indigenous Youth Employment Program supports Indigenous youth between the ages of 17-29 to overcome barriers and acquire skills and training to achieve sustainable employment. The position works out of Drive Youth Employment Services, Frog Hollow Neighbourhood Houses’ youth satellite, and work in the community. The position reports to the IYEP Program Coordinator.
Hours: 28 hours per week (Monday – Thursday)
Contract: ASAP until March 31, 2025 with possibility of extension
